<br />DEED OF TRUST
<br />THIS TRUST DEED made this 4th day of March, 2003, between
<br />GARY EILENSTINE and LINDA EILENSTINE Husband and Wife, as
<br />TRUSTORS, whose address is &i /for l�Z s �C �ff�Jry�
<br />WILLIAM A. FRANCIS, A Member of the Nebraska State Bar Association, °
<br />as TRUSTEE, whose address is 222 N. Cedar Street, P. O. Box 2280,
<br />Grand Island, Nebraska 68802; and THE MEADOWS APARTMENT HOMES,
<br />L.L.C., A Nebraska Limited Liability Company, BENEFICIARY.
<br />WITNESSETH:
<br />That TRUSTORS hereby grant, bargain, sell, convey and warrant
<br />to TRUSTEE, IN TRUST, his successors and assigns, with power of
<br />sale, the following- described real property:
<br />Lots Seventeen (17) and Eighteen (18) , in Country Meadows
<br />Subdivision, in the City of Grand Island, Hall County,
<br />Nebraska,
<br />together with all buildings, improvements and appurtenances
<br />thereon.
<br />The TRUSTORS hereby covenant and agree with the TRUSTEE and
<br />BENEFICIARY that they are lawfully seized and owners of the above -
<br />described property; that they have good right and lawful authority
<br />to sell and convey said premises and that said premises are free
<br />and clear of all liens and encumbrances except for a first mortgage
<br />construction loan, and further, that TRUSTORS will warrant and
<br />defend the title to said premises forever against the claims of all
<br />persons whomsoever.
<br />For the purpose of securing performance of each agreement of
<br />TRUSTORS herein contained and the payment of ELEVEN THOUSAND EIGHT
<br />HUNDRED THIRTY DOLLARS ($11,830.00), the TRUSTORS have executed a
<br />Promissory Note bearing even date, at the rate of interest and on
<br />the terms and conditions as set forth in such Note until paid. The
<br />Promissory Note shall become due and payable on March 4, 2004, or
<br />upon sale of the above - described real estate pursuant to the terms
<br />and conditions of the Promissory Note.
<br />It is agreed by and between the parties hereto that while
<br />title is vested in the TRUSTEE and until filing of Notice of
<br />Default, the TRUSTORS shall:
<br />A. Retain possession of the property at all times, except as may
<br />be otherwise agreed by the parties in writing.
<br />B. Maintain the building and its improvements and all personal
<br />property sold under the parties' Contract for Sale of Real
<br />Estate, in good condition and repair.
<br />C. Pay all general and special taxes and all special assessments
<br />of every kind levied or assessed against or due upon said
<br />property before delinquency, and to deliver to BENEFICIARY
<br />copies of receipts showing payment of such taxes.
